Comparative Protein Structure Modeling:
From Protein Sequence to High-accuracy Protein Structure


EMSL Project ID
13304

Abstract

We propose to implement a computational pipeline for high-accuracy protein structure prediction from protein sequence, and carry out testing and evaluation of this computational pipeline on proteins with low sequence identities (< 25%) with their native-like structural folds in the PDB database. This computational pipeline will consist of computational tools for (a) protein fold recognition, (b) sequence-structure alignment, (c) prediction of side-chains, and (d) structural refinement using molecular mechanics methods.
